September 9
Il Document Object Model (DOM) è un modo di rappresentare una pagina Web in termini di elementi di markup e il contenuto. Ogni tag HTML è rappresentato come nodo in un albero DOM. È possibile accedere e / o modificare il contenuto o la struttura della pagina facendo riferimento a parti del suo albero DOM in JavaScript. Cancellare l'attributo di "stile" di un elemento HTML con Javascript per rimuovere gli stili CSS applicati ad esso.
1 Inserire il codice seguente tra i tag "testa" del documento HTML:
<Script type = "text / javascript">
Funzione clearStyle (id) {
document.getElementById(id).setAttribute("style","");
document.getElementById (id) .style.cssText = "";
}
</ Script>
La seconda linea è necessario per rendere il codice compatibile con Internet Explorer.
2 Aggiungere il seguente codice al corpo del documento HTML per testare la funzione "clearStyle":
<Div id = stile "div1" = "font-size: 200%; text-align: center;"> Styled testo </ div>
<Input type = valore "pulsante" = "Rimuovi Style" onclick = "clearStyle ( 'div1');" />
3 Salvare la pagina e caricare in un browser Web. Fare clic sul pulsante per rimuovere gli stili dall'elemento DIV. Il testo si restringe immediatamente alle dimensioni normali e diventa allineato a sinistra. Assegnare un ID univoco a ogni elemento da cui si desidera rimuovere gli stili, quindi utilizzare il suo ID nella chiamata a "clearStyle."